An apartment in the city of Yamim in Netanya became 50% more expensive within four years; “Prices will continue to rise”

by time news

The story of a building

On the last day of 2021, a second-hand 5-room apartment on the first floor of a tower on Natan Yonatan Street in the Ir Yamim neighborhood of Netanya was sold for NIS 4.09 million. According to Madlan, the area of ​​the apartment is 135 square meters, so the price reflects a value of NIS 30.26 thousand per square meter.

Exactly 4 years earlier, on 31/12/2017, the same apartment on the same floor and with the same area was sold by the entrepreneurial company YH Dimari for NIS 2.69 million, ie NIS 19.96 thousand per square meter. However, the seller recorded a profit of NIS 1.61 million within 4 years, and a handsome return of 52%.

The housing price index also jumped during this period, but by about 18%. Therefore, part of the increase in the value of the apartment can be attributed to the state of the housing market across the country, but it seems that buyers give Dimeri’s tower in particular, and the city in particular days added value for which they are willing to pay more.

The most notable advantage of the neighborhood is its location on the seafront – this specific tower is located a few hundred meters from the beach and the promenade from which the residents of the neighborhood enjoy. The shiny new towers are in demand and preferred by many over old apartments, the proximity to a large and well-known mall, and the public gardens (6 according to the Netanya Municipality website) also give the neighborhood an advantage. In addition, the fact that hairy days on the outskirts of Netanya on the descent to the coastal road are especially attractive to those who work in the Tel Aviv area.

Also compared to other neighborhoods in Netanya, a prestigious and sought-after city of days. In 2021, the average price per square meter was NIS 29.6 thousand, while in eastern Kiryat Hasharon in the Netanya neighborhoods the price was only NIS 22.3 thousand per square meter. In the center of Netanya, the price is about NIS 20,000 per square meter.

Tal Kopel, CEO of Madlan, said that “Ir Yamim is a clear example of what can be achieved outside Gush Dan at similar prices. For the price of a 5-room apartment in Givatayim, you can get a 5-room apartment in a building with a pool, gym, easy access to the beach and even “A nature reserve within walking distance. Those who purchased for the investment made a nice return, and with the completion of construction in the neighborhood in the coming years and its uniqueness, it is likely that prices there will continue to rise and widen the gap from the rest of the city.”

The project we examined with the help of Madlan includes three 17-14 storey buildings, and a total of 170 apartments. The Ir Yamim neighborhood was planned in the late 20th century, construction began in 2006. Dimeri received a building permit in July 2016, and within a few months began selling apartments. The construction of the project has recently been completed, and these are currently inhabiting the 3rd and final building.

As in the whole country, also in these towers during the year 2021 there is a sharp jump in prices. At the end of 2016 and the beginning of 2017, apartments were sold at a value of NIS 21,000 per square meter, towards the end of 2020 the price per square meter reached NIS 23,000 – an increase of 9.5% on average within 3 years. On the other hand, as stated at the end of 2021, the average price per square meter of weapons per NIS 30,000 is an increase of about 20% on average within two years.

The most expensive apartments in the towers that Dimeri built are those on the upper floors, and especially the large penthouse apartments. According to Madlan, the expensive apartment in the tower was sold in October 2021 for NIS 8,135 million, this is an apartment on the 17th floor that spans 219 square meters, so the price reflects a value of NIS 37.1 thousand per square meter. A slightly smaller apartment, with an area of ​​209 square meters, was sold in February 2022 according to a key of NIS 37.8 thousand per square meter, and in total its price was NIS 7.9 million. A huge apartment with an area of ​​222 square meters was sold in November 2019 at a value of NIS 28.6 thousand per square meter, and in total its price was NIS 6.3 million. So the luxury apartments in the project became 32% more expensive within two years.

A typical 5-room apartment (only 135 square meters) on the 14th floor was sold by Dimeri in March this year for NIS 4.58 million at a value of NIS 33.9 thousand per square meter. Exactly one year earlier, the company sold an apartment of the same size and floor at a value of NIS 24.59 thousand per square meter – the price of the apartment in February 2021 was NIS 3.32 million. An increase in value of almost 38% or NIS 1.26 million within a year.
